 AUSTIN, TX (December 14, 2012) – The Austin Trail of Lights, set to kick off on Sunday evening, will not only celebrate the spirit of the holiday season, but will provide an opportunity for the community to connect and strengthen Austin with creative ideas and new perspectives through the GiveTogether Austin campaign.

Twenty-three nonprofit organizations have joined forces to make up the GiveTogether Austin campaign, which will be on display inside the Trail of Lights Village, made possible by Dell, at Zilker Park.  Throughout the eight days of festivities, GiveTogether Austin’s platform will provide a great opportunity to reflect on the accomplishments of 2012 and set goals for continued advancements for Austin in the coming year while highlighting four specific issues:

Health & Wellness: Organizations representing the health and wellness community will share information about innovative programs to help Central Texans adopt healthy habits.

Youth & Education:  Each organization will offer a different approach, a new perspective and unique solutions that will keep Austin educated, capable and growing.

Environment: These organizations will highlight their innovative solutions tokeep Austin a vibrant, resourceful and enjoyable place to call home.

Social Services: These organizations are making sure all members of the community are integrated and contributing to Austin’s success.
